The hexadecimal color code #97599E corresponds to the code RGB( 151, 89, 158 ). It's a shade of Pink. This color is a combination of red (at 0,59 level), green (at 0,35 level) and blue (at 0,62 level). Its brightness is 48% and its saturation is 27%. It is composed of red at 37%, green at 22% and blue at 39%.
